You are creative, organized, and excited to be in a careerin marketing and communications. You enjoy engaging with the public, creatingmarketing materials and campaigns, and managing social media channels. You liketo build brand awareness and enhance the overall effectiveness ofcommunications.

As the Marketing and Communications Manager, youwill lead the development and execution of GSL Group’s corporate marketing andcommunications initiatives that strengthen brand awareness, enhance thecompany’s reputation, and support organizational objectives. You will beresponsible for managing corporate communications, social media channels,website content, public relations activities, and the creation of marketingmaterials. You will also provide strategic support to business units throughbranding initiatives, website enhancements, and project-based marketingactivities.

Key Responsibilities

Development and execution of GSL Group'scorporate marketing and communications initiatives to strengthen brandawareness and organizational reputation.

Manages the marketing and communicationsactivities for GSL's foundations, including campaigns, events, donorcommunications, impact stories, and promotional materials.

Manages GSL Group's corporate socialmedia channels by developing content calendars, creating engaging content,and monitoring performance.

Manages and maintains the GSL corporatewebsite, ensuring content remains current, accurate, and aligned withbrand standards.

Develops GSL Group’s marketing andcommunications materials including presentations, brochures, newsletters,media releases,



and other corporate collateral.

Supports public relations activities bydrafting communications, coordinating media opportunities, and promotingGSL's corporate initiatives and community impact.

Ensures the consistent application of GSLGroup's brand standards across corporate communications and marketingmaterials.

Provides occasional project-basedmarketing and communications support to GSL business units, includingbranding initiatives, website updates, and marketing materials.

Monitors marketing and communicationsperformance and provides recommendations to improve engagement, brandvisibility, and overall effectiveness.

In an ideal world, you would havepost-secondary education in Design, Marketing, Communications,Journalism, or a related field, along with strong experience with websitecontent management systems (e.g., WordPress or similar) and social mediamanagement platforms. You understand SEO, Google Analytics and Email marketingplatforms. Experience with website hosting, domains, DNS management, and digitalphotography and video editing are an asset.
